Cisco RVS4000 and WRVS4400N Web Management Private/Public Key's Information Disclosure Vulnerability

BID:47985

Info

Cisco RVS4000 and WRVS4400N Web Management Private/Public Key's Information Disclosure Vulnerability

Bugtraq ID: 47985
Class: Design Error
CVE: CVE-2011-1647
Remote: Yes
Local: No
Published: May 25 2011 12:00AM
Updated: Jun 17 2011 05:50PM
Credit: Cisco
Vulnerable: Cisco WRVS4400N Wireless-N Gigabit Security Router 2
Cisco WRVS4400N Wireless-N Gigabit Security Router 1.1
Cisco WRVS4400N Wireless-N Gigabit Security Router 1.0
Cisco RVS4000 4-port Gigabit Security Router 1.3.2 .0
Cisco RVS4000 4-port Gigabit Security Router 2
Cisco RVS4000 4-port Gigabit Security Router 1.3.0.3
Cisco RVS4000 4-port Gigabit Security Router 0
Not Vulnerable: Cisco WRVS4400N Wireless-N Gigabit Security Router 2.0.2.1
Cisco RVS4000 4-port Gigabit Security Router 2.0.2.7
Cisco RVS4000 4-port Gigabit Security Router 1.3.3.5

Discussion

Cisco RVS4000 and WRVS4400N Web Management Private/Public Key's Information Disclosure Vulnerability

Cisco RVS4000 and WRVS4400N are prone to an information-disclosure vulnerability that affects the web-management interface.

Remote attackers can exploit this issue to gain access to the administrator's SSL certificate's private and public keys.
